Automatic Aluminium Wheels Hub Inspection NDT X Ray Equipment System The inspection systems are mostly integrated as inline-systems in a foundry. Most requirements of an inspection system are based on detection of defects and on the inline - integration in an industrial environment. 1. high availability (approx. > 95%) 2. high throughput (>80 wheels per hour) 3. detection of all relevant defects with a minimum of false rejects 4. minimum of maintenance effort 5. easy system
